💡 Result:

For Appwrite Sites deployments (POST /v1/sites/{siteId}/deployments), the code field is a gzip file sent as multipart/form-data. (appwrite.io)

If your deployment archive is > 5MB, Appwrite’s upload endpoints (including Create Deployment) support resumable 5MB chunked uploads using these headers: (appwrite.io)

  • Content-Range: bytes <first>-<last>/<total> (byte offsets for the current chunk) (appwrite.io)
  • X-Appwrite-ID: <ID> (the upload/deployment/file ID that subsequent chunks belong to) (appwrite.io)

Notes:

  • Header names are case-insensitive, so x-appwrite-id works the same as X-Appwrite-ID in practice. (appwrite.io)
  • Pattern is: send the first chunk (server returns an object/ID), then send remaining chunks with the same Content-Range scheme and X-Appwrite-ID set to that returned ID. (appwrite.io)

Fix Content-Range header calculation for final chunk in chunked deployment uploads.

The chunked upload contract (headers and endpoint) aligns with Appwrite's documented API for Sites deployments. However, the Content-Range header has a bug: when constructing the final chunk, the code incorrectly uses $deployment->getSize() as the end byte position instead of $deployment->getSize() - 1.

Per RFC 7233, the end position must be an inclusive 0-based byte offset. For a 1000-byte file, the final chunk should send bytes 800-999/1000, not bytes 800-1000/1000. Change the conditional:

'content-range' => 'bytes ' . ($deployment->getStart()) . '-' . ($deployment->getEnd() == ($deployment->getSize() - 1) ? $deployment->getSize() - 1 : $deployment->getEnd()) . '/' . $deployment->getSize(),

@premtsd-code, you're absolutely right that the Appwrite server currently handles this! The server-side code shows it accepts both formats:

if ($end === $fileSize - 1 || $end === $fileSize) {

However, I noticed the TODO comment in that same code:

// TODO remove the condition that checks $end === $fileSize in next breaking version

This indicates the server is only accepting $end === $fileSize for backward compatibility and plans to remove it in a future breaking version. The migration code is currently sending the non-RFC-compliant format that will eventually be unsupported.

Recommendation: While it works today, I'd suggest updating the migration code to use the RFC 7233-compliant format ($fileSize - 1) to future-proof against the planned server-side change.
